| // type_traits |
| |
| // underlying_type |
| |
| #include <type_traits> |
| #include <climits> |
| |
| #include "test_macros.h" |
| |
| enum E { V = INT_MIN }; |
| |
| #if !defined(_WIN32) || defined(__MINGW32__) |
| #define TEST_UNSIGNED_UNDERLYING_TYPE 1 |
| #else |
| #define TEST_UNSIGNED_UNDERLYING_TYPE 0 // MSVC's ABI doesn't follow the Standard |
| #endif |
| |
| #if TEST_UNSIGNED_UNDERLYING_TYPE |
| enum F { W = UINT_MAX }; |
| #endif // TEST_UNSIGNED_UNDERLYING_TYPE |
| |
| int main(int, char**) |
| { |
| ASSERT_SAME_TYPE(int, std::underlying_type<E>::type); |
| #if TEST_UNSIGNED_UNDERLYING_TYPE |
| ASSERT_SAME_TYPE(unsigned, std::underlying_type<F>::type); |
| #endif // TEST_UNSIGNED_UNDERLYING_TYPE |
| |
| #if TEST_STD_VER > 11 |
| ASSERT_SAME_TYPE(int, std::underlying_type_t<E>); |
| #if TEST_UNSIGNED_UNDERLYING_TYPE |
| ASSERT_SAME_TYPE(unsigned, std::underlying_type_t<F>); |
| #endif // TEST_UNSIGNED_UNDERLYING_TYPE |
| #endif // TEST_STD_VER > 11 |
| |
| #if TEST_STD_VER >= 11 |
| enum G : char { }; |
| |
| ASSERT_SAME_TYPE(char, std::underlying_type<G>::type); |
| #if TEST_STD_VER > 11 |
| ASSERT_SAME_TYPE(char, std::underlying_type_t<G>); |
| #endif // TEST_STD_VER > 11 |
| #endif // TEST_STD_VER >= 11 |
| |
| return 0; |
| } |
